How they compare

Saint Vincent and the Grenadines currently reports 1.02 GPIA against 1.01 GPIA in Nicaragua, a difference of 0.01 GPIA.

The two have swapped places 4 times across 18 shared years of data; in 1971 it was Saint Vincent and the Grenadines ahead.

Nicaragua ranks 109th and Saint Vincent and the Grenadines ranks 106th of 212 countries.

Across the 5 decades both report, Nicaragua averaged higher in 2 and Saint Vincent and the Grenadines in 3.

Head to head by decade

Decade Nicaragua Saint Vincent and the Grenadines Difference Ahead
1970s 0.9505 GPIA 1.17 GPIA 0.2202 GPIA Saint Vincent and the Grenadines
1980s 1.37 GPIA 1.34 GPIA 0.0267 GPIA Nicaragua
2000s 1.1 GPIA 1.17 GPIA 0.0694 GPIA Saint Vincent and the Grenadines
2010s 1.08 GPIA 1.08 GPIA 0.0021 GPIA Nicaragua
2020s 1.01 GPIA 1.02 GPIA 0.011 GPIA Saint Vincent and the Grenadines

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
